The future of COVID-19 testing
Author(s)Chris Mazzolini
What the BA.2 variant, the ending of mask mandates and allergy season means for COVID-19 testing.
Advertisement
COVID-19 is on the rise again. At the same time many mask and social distancing mandates are ending. And, lastly, allergy season is upon us, which means many of your patients may be unsure if they have COVID-19 or allergy symptoms.
To discuss these trends, Medical Economics sat down with Joseph Mann, MSN, FNP-C, of BD Life Sciences. Watch the interview below.
